Description: A desperate mother's yearning for her daughter's happiness unravels into a chilling descent in Carlos Vermut's "Magical Girl." This isn't a whimsical fairy tale; it's a brutal exploration of societal pressures and the agonizing lengths to which we'll go for those we love. Vermut masterfully crafts a suffocating atmosphere of moral ambiguity, leaving the viewer questioning the true cost of desire. The film's unsettling power lies not in jump scares, but in the quiet desperation etched onto the faces of its characters, their choices echoing the agonizing compromises we all face in life. "Magical Girl" is a disturbing masterpiece, a haunting examination of hope, delusion, and the dark side of parental love. Prepare to be unsettled, yet profoundly moved.
